Abstract

A closed-form expression for the two-dimensional Green's function of a semi-infinite anisotropic dielectric in the wavenumber space is presented, and then the validity and definiteness of the ob- tained expression for arbitrary values of the wavenumber vector is proven. The derived Green's function is the Fourier transform of the potential response to a point-charge source located on the surface of a constantly stressed semi-infinite anisotropic dielectric. Therefore it is the most significant part in calculating the two-dimensional charge density and field distribution of the surface acoustic wave interdigital transducers in the case of the electrostatic approximation. The inte- grals associated with the inverse Fourier transform of the derived Green's function are discussed.
